Solutions for "emit crossword clue" by Letter Count
4 Letters
GIVE: To produce or send out, as in "give off heat."
SEND: To cause to go or be conveyed, often implying emission of signals or messages.
VENT: To express or release, often used for feelings or gases.
5 Letters
EXUDE: To discharge (liquid or smell) slowly and steadily, or to display an emotion strongly.
ISSUE: To send out or produce something, like a sound or a formal statement.
7 Letters
RADIATE: To send out rays or waves, typically from a central point, like heat, light, or an emotion.
9 Letters
DISCHARGE: To release or send out, often something that has been contained, such as a fluid or a responsibility.
More About "emit crossword clue"
"Emit" is a versatile verb frequently encountered in crossword puzzles, and its meaning centers around the act of sending something out or giving something off. This can be anything from physical substances like light, heat, or gas, to intangible things like sounds, smells, or even emotions. The challenge in crosswords lies in discerning the exact nuance the clue intends, often depending on the letter count or other intersecting words.
Common scenarios for "emit" clues include natural phenomena (e.g., 'stars emit light'), biological processes (e.g., 'plants emit oxygen'), or human actions (e.g., 'to emit a sigh'). Understanding these contexts can significantly narrow down the possibilities. Pay close attention to any additional words in the clue that might hint at a specific type of emission, such as 'emit light' suggesting 'RADIATE' or 'emit smell' pointing towards 'EXUDE'.
